This is typical T2+ racial resistance bonus. It consists of basic profile (0-20-40-50 for shields and 50-35-25-20 for armor) and two resistance values (both for shield and armour) buffed against stereotypical damage profile of faction's main enemy. So, Amarr have their Kin and Exp resistance buffed (well, projectiles have various damage types, but T2 ammo indicates kin-exp profile, so...), Minmatar have bonuses against Amarr lasers (EM and Therm), Caldari and Gallente tank up against Kin and Therm (both use hybrid turrets and Caldari also favour mostly Kin missiles).
Knowing that, you can now see why some ships are so loved as ratting ones (Tengu or, say, shield Ishtar - imagine them against Guristas), or why T2 Amarr armour and Minmatar shield profiles are considered pretty good for random PvP stuff - they have natural holes patched by racial resistances. |

As with all T2 resistances the enhanced T3 resists follow the system by which they receive the equivalent of two active hardeners for the racial enemy's primary damage (Kinetic is primary for Caldari for example and therefore Gallente recieve two hardeners worth of Kinetic resists) and a single hardener's worth for their enemy's secondary.
While that seems to be win/win for Amarr and Minmatar with ships like the Curse and the Muninn (the Curse generally used with a shield tank and the Muninn classically an armour ship) the resist 'holes' become even more glaring. |
